Introduction of Roof Covering Materials



When it pertains to picking the appropriate roofing products for your home, you've got lots of alternatives to think about. Each material supplies one-of-a-kind advantages and features, making it critical to discover the one that finest suits your requirements.

Asphalt shingles are popular for their price and simplicity of installment. They can be found in different shades and designs, enabling you to improve your home's visual allure without breaking the bank.

If you're searching for something more durable, consider metal roof covering. It's understood for its longevity and can withstand rough weather, making it optimal for property owners in areas with severe environments.

Wood drinks can include an all-natural, rustic charm to your home, however they require more upkeep than other options.

Tile roof coverings are an additional choice, offering an one-of-a-kind aesthetic and exceptional insulation buildings, though they can be heavier and pricier.

Lastly, there's slate, which is incredibly durable and can last for over a century, however it is just one of the most expensive options.

Considering the benefits and drawbacks of each material aids guarantee you make a knowledgeable choice that improves both the appeal and capability of your home.

Advantages and disadvantages of Metal Roof Covering



Steel roof uses a compelling mix of toughness and energy effectiveness, making it a popular choice amongst homeowners. One substantial advantage is its long lifespan; metal roofs can last 50 years or even more with proper maintenance.

They're also resistant to severe weather conditions, consisting of heavy snow, rainfall, and wind. In addition, steel reflects sunshine, which helps reduce cooling down costs in warm climates.

Nevertheless, there are some downsides to consider. Metal roof can be a lot more costly upfront contrasted to typical materials, which may stress your spending plan.

Installment can likewise be complicated, needing skilled specialists to make certain a correct fit and seal. If you reside in a noisy area, you might locate that throughout heavy rain or hailstorm, the sound can be enhanced, potentially disturbing your peace.

Benefits and drawbacks of Asphalt Shingles



Asphalt roof shingles are one of the most popular roof products for house owners because of their price and simplicity of installment. They can be found in a variety of colors and styles, allowing you to match your home's visual.

Among the most significant advantages is the price; asphalt tiles are generally less costly than other roof products. Their installation is straightforward, making it quick and convenient for contractors to put them on your roof.


Nevertheless, there are some disadvantages to take into consideration. Asphalt shingles typically have a shorter life-span, averaging around 15 to 30 years, depending upon the top quality.

They're additionally susceptible to harm from high winds and hail storm, which can result in costly fixings. Furthermore, asphalt roof shingles aren't the most environmentally friendly option, as they're petroleum-based and can add to landfill waste at the end of their life.
